Transaction 06570826eccfbe499af37b20b83aa13aa052a149e219d6df743230034a768557

1 Input
2 Outputs
  • 06570826eccfbe499af37b20b83aa13aa052a149e219d6df743230034a768557:0
  • value  252650
    address  349ZYJo6kYX8LVurSQyd1q1sfnvpPoHLe9
  • 06570826eccfbe499af37b20b83aa13aa052a149e219d6df743230034a768557:1
  • value  4940404
    address  18whRmzTppKGxgkhMWuHV97YrzXiqRb6J